This is an OCR edition with typos. Excerpt from book: 15. By Dedication.? Dedication is an offer of the land by the owner, and acceptance of it by the public, for public use. The owner of the fee may do this in any way by which his intention to dedicate plainly appears, by parol, by deed or in any other way. But where a statute provides the manner in which the dedication is to be made, a substantial compliance with its provisions is necessary.1 Dedication can not be made by any other than the owner, or his agent, having authority from him for that purpose.' No person in possession without title can dedicate so as to bind the holder of the title;' nor can even a mortgagor bind the mortgagee to a dedication without the latter1s assent.' 16. By Prescription.?Use of a way by the public under claim of right for a great length of time, without objection by theowner, may result in converting the private propertv so used into a highway. But, before a highway can be established by prescription, it must appear that the general public, under a claim of right, and not by mere permission of the owner, used some defined way without interruption or substantial change for the period of twenty years or more.' The user must be continuous. Interruption, even if it be after nineteen years continuous use, will start the prescription afresh from the time the occupation is resumed. 1 Baker v. Book excerpt: As Evan Friss shows in his mordant history of urban bicycling in the late nineteenth century, the bicycle has long told us much about cities and their residents. In a time when American cities were chaotic, polluted, and socially and culturally impenetrable, the bicycle inspired a vision of an improved city in which pollution was negligible, transport was noiseless and rapid, leisure spaces were democratic, and the divisions between city and country blurred. Friss focuses not on the technology of the bicycle but on the urbanisms that bicycling engendered. Bicycles altered the look and feel of cities and their streets, enhanced mobility, fueled leisure and recreation, promoted good health, and shrank urban spaces as part of a larger transformation that altered the city and the lives of its inhabitants, even as the bicycle's own popularity fell, not to rise again for a century. --Publisher's description.
